HS Code 7415 — Copper Fasteners and Hardware

This heading includes various copper fasteners such as nails, screws, bolts, nuts, and rivets. It also covers steel or iron fasteners if they have copper heads.

What's included

  • Brass wood screws
  • Copper rivets for leather
  • Copper-headed steel nails
  • Copper washers and cotters

What's excluded

  • Copper staples in strips → use 8305 (Staples in strips for office use or industrial staplers are in 8305.)

Common examples

  • M6 brass hexagonal nuts
  • Copper nails for boat building
  • Solid copper rivets
  • Brass flat washers

Frequently asked questions

What if the screw is only plated with copper?

If the screw is steel but merely plated with copper, it remains under 7318 (Steel). This code 7415 is for solid copper/brass or items with a substantial copper head.

Trade & shipping notes

  • Typical duty range: 0% - 6%
  • Documentation: Check for Anti-Dumping Duties (ADD) which are common for fasteners.
  • Typical shipping mode: LCL
  • Top exporters: China, Germany, Taiwan, India
  • Top importers: United States, Germany, United Kingdom, Japan

Key takeaway

Covers copper and brass fixing hardware, including specialized marine-grade fasteners.
